Pasternack expands its line of broadband bias tees

Pasternack has introduced a series of bias tees. They address a variety of applications, including test and measurement, research and development, optical communications, satellite communications, and more.

Pasternack’s expanded bias tee offering includes various design configurations that cover a broad range of frequencies from 12KHz to 40GHz, high DC current and voltage handling up to 7A and 100V, and high port isolation of 30dB typical.

A variety of coaxial packaged configurations are available, featuring SMA, 2.92mm, and N-type RF ports as well as DC Pin, SMA and BNC DC ports.

These new bias tees feature compact and rugged aluminium packaged designs that utilise a chemical conversion coating for added protection from oxidation. Also, they support greater operational temperature ranges from -55°C to +105°C, providing resiliency in harsh environments.

“Our new bias tees are ideal for reliably setting DC bias points for your electronic components without disturbing other components in your network.
